Understanding the Importance of Holt Biology Answer Keys
Holt Biology is a widely used textbook, known for its comprehensive coverage of biological principles. However, its complexity can be daunting for some students. A Holt Biology answer key can be an invaluable tool, but it’s crucial to use it responsibly and strategically. The key isn't just about getting the right answers; it's about understanding why those answers are correct.
#### The Ethical Use of Answer Keys
Using an answer key to cheat is counterproductive and undermines your learning. The true value lies in using it as a tool for self-assessment and identifying areas where you need extra help. Compare your answers to the key, focusing on understanding the reasoning behind the correct responses. If you consistently get questions wrong, it signals a gap in your understanding that requires further attention.
#### Beyond the Answer: Mastering the Concepts
Simply memorizing answers without comprehending the underlying principles is ineffective. Use the answer key to pinpoint your weak areas, then revisit the relevant chapters in the textbook, consult online resources, or seek help from your teacher or tutor. Active learning, focusing on understanding the "why," is key to long-term retention and success in biology.

Effective Strategies for Using Holt Biology Answer Keys
Simply looking up answers isn't enough. Here's how to maximize the benefits of using a Holt Biology answer key:
#### Attempt the Questions First:
Always try to answer the questions independently before consulting the answer key. This helps you identify your strengths and weaknesses accurately.
#### Analyze Your Mistakes:
When you get a question wrong, don't just move on. Carefully review the explanation for the correct answer, focusing on the underlying concepts and principles.
#### Seek Clarification:
If you consistently struggle with a particular concept, don't hesitate to seek help from your teacher, tutor, or classmates.
#### Practice Regularly:
Consistent practice is crucial for mastering biology. Use the answer key to check your work and identify areas needing improvement.
